Beginner’s Guide to Revenue Cycle Automation for Provider Revenue Operations
Provider revenue operations often begin automation discussions after backlogs, staffing pressure, or payer follow up volume becomes difficult to manage. Revenue cycle automation can reduce repetitive work, but only when leaders choose the right workflows, define exceptions, and plan for production ownership. A practical starting point is not a large technology program. It is a disciplined review of where manual work is stable, high volume, rules based, and operationally important.
Why Providers Need a Workflow First View of Automation
RCM work crosses patient access, eligibility, authorization, coding, claims, denials, payment posting, and AR follow up. Automating one task without understanding upstream and downstream dependencies can simply move the bottleneck. For an RCM leader, that creates hidden queues and inconsistent handoffs. For a CIO, it creates support risk when bots depend on changing screens, credentials, portals, or business rules. The workflow must be understood before the automation is designed.
Which Revenue Cycle Workflows Are Good Starting Candidates
Good candidates include eligibility checks, payer portal claim status, authorization follow up, missing information reminders, claim file validation, denial categorization, appeal packet preparation, remittance data checks, payment posting support, underpayment identification, and AR worklist updates. The best first use case has clear triggers, stable rules, consistent data, known exceptions, and a business owner. A provider should avoid starting with a process that changes daily or depends heavily on judgment unless the automation is limited to administrative support.
The Difference Between Automating a Task and Improving RCM
A bot can complete a repetitive step, but operational improvement requires queue ownership, exception handling, monitoring, audit trails, and a response plan when the source system changes. Consider a team that manually checks 300 claims in payer portals. Automating the login and status retrieval may save effort, but the real value comes from routing denials, missing information, and no response cases to the correct owners with consistent notes. The workflow improves only when the automated output changes how the team acts.
A Simple Revenue Cycle Automation Maturity Path
Stage one is manual work recognition: identify where teams spend time and where delays create revenue risk. Stage two is process discovery: map triggers, systems, owners, handoffs, rules, and exceptions. Stage three is readiness: confirm data quality, access, control requirements, and success measures. Stage four is build and test: design for real cases, not only ideal ones. Stage five is production ownership: monitor runs, maintain credentials, manage changes, and review exception trends. Stage six is continuous improvement based on run logs and business feedback.

How Providers Should Plan the First Automation Use Case
Choose one workflow with meaningful volume and manageable complexity. Baseline the current effort, error categories, turnaround time, backlog, and escalation pattern. Define what the bot will do, what it will never decide, and how exceptions will reach a person. Test system downtime, missing data, changed screens, expired credentials, and unusual payer responses. Assign a business owner and a technical owner before go live. After launch, review bot runs and exception patterns weekly until the process is stable.

Q. Which RCM workflow should providers automate first?
Start with a stable, repetitive, high volume process such as eligibility checks, claim status retrieval, remittance validation, or workqueue updates. The workflow should have clear rules, known exceptions, and a committed business owner.
Q. Why do RCM bots need monitoring after go live?
Payer portals, screens, credentials, business rules, and source data can change after deployment. Monitoring helps teams detect failures quickly, protect queue visibility, and prevent silent backlog growth.
